21/07/2008, 16:08
|
| | | Fecha de Ingreso: noviembre-2002 Ubicación: Lima - Limon
Mensajes: 207
Antigüedad: 22 años Puntos: 0 | |
hitTestObject as3 Buenas,,,tengo en el escenario una nave , y el otro 4 instancias de una clase triangulo,,,resulta que la rutina de abajo , solo es cierta cuando i=4 , en las otras 3 o sea i=1,2,3 es falsa ( teniendo que ser verdadera cuando se intersectan ) ...por favor denme una mano con esto...
gracias....
nave.addEventListener (Event.ENTER_FRAME, volar);
function volar (eve:Event):void
{
eve.target[coord] += vel*dir;
for (var i=1; i<=4; i++)
{
var n:String="triangulo"+i;
var t=getChildByName(n);
if ( t.hitTestObject( eve.target))
{
mensaje.text="Choca la nave al objeto" + i;
}
else
{
mensaje.text="";
}
}
} |